Dealing With Eviction Help: Protecting Your Rights and Home
Eviction can be a difficult time, leaving you feeling overwhelmed. It's important to remember that you have legal protections under the law. First, make every effort to communicate your landlord about your situation for falling behind on rent. They may be willing to work with you to create an agreement.
If communication fails, it's crucial to consult with an attorney. A lawyer can advise you through the eviction process and protect your rights.
Remember that an eviction notice doesn't mean you automatically have to leave your home. Explore your options carefully, as there are often resources available to keep a roof over your head.

Facing Eviction: Support Every Step of the Way
Facing eviction is often an incredibly stressful and overwhelming experience. It can seem as though your whole world is crumbling. But don't despair, you are not alone in this situation, and there can be found resources available to help you every step of the way.
One of the most important things you can do is become familiar with your rights as a tenant. Every state has its own regulations regarding eviction, so it's crucial to research what applies in your area. You should also reaching out to a legal aid organization or an attorney who specializes in tenant rights. They can give you with advice on how to navigate the eviction process and protect your rights.
Remember, you are not powerless in this situation. By reaching out for assistance, you can improve your odds of overcoming this challenging time.
